    Hi! Additive synthesis uses only sine waves. If we use this feature, then we are building cool complex waveforms to combine, but they aren't necessarily all sine waves. If you use that feature with just one one oscillator, it limits our synthesis opportunities to only upper partials that belong to the harmonic series; it also lacks great fine-tuning controls. Because of that, I don't think that feature is the most useful for additive synthesis and I didn't include it. It is a cool thing to mess with, though.

    ​@@DavidEFarrell Actually, the 64 harmonics are each a sine wave in the harmonic series, and messing with those is the primary way to do additive synthesis in operator. The whole point is to create more complex waveforms out of those 64 sine waves. Some synths allow you to have each harmonic represented by a complex waveform, but operator doesn't do this. It's a feature I've only seen in Alchemy.
